#2328b6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2328b6 is composed of 13.7% red, 15.7% green and 71.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.8% cyan, 78% magenta, 0%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 238 degrees, a saturation of 67.7% and a lightness of 42.5%. #2328b6 color hex could be obtained by blending #4650ff with #00006d.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#2328b6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2328b6 has RGB values of R:35, G:40, B:182 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 2304182.

Hex triplet 2328b6 #2328b6
RGB Decimal 35, 40, 182 rgb(35,40,182)
RGB Percent 13.7, 15.7, 71.4 rgb(13.7%,15.7%,71.4%)
CMYK 81, 78, 0, 29
HSL 238°, 67.7, 42.5 hsl(238,67.7%,42.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 238°, 80.8, 71.4
Web Safe 3333cc #3333cc
CIE-LAB 27.44, 47.962, -73.798
XYZ 9.894, 5.252, 44.746
xyY 0.165, 0.088, 5.252
CIE-LCH 27.44, 88.014, 303.021
CIE-LUV 27.44, -7.241, -91.426
Hunter-Lab 22.916, 36.96, -99.725
Binary 00100011, 00101000, 10110110

Shades and Tints of #2328b6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f0f0f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#2328b6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666673 is the less saturated color, while #0209d7 is the most saturated one.
